Help Lancaster detectives ID mail thief

by The AV Times Staff • November 13, 2020 4 Comments

[Images via LASD]
LANCASTER – If you recognize this man, then Lancaster Sheriff’s Station detectives would like to hear from you.

The suspect is wanted for theft.

He is accused of stealing mail from a local residence.

“With the holiday season coming up, let’s make sure mail thieves are not on our streets,” reads a news release from the Lancaster Sheriff’s Station.

Anyone with information on the identity or location of this suspect is encouraged to contact Detective Bivins at 661-948-8466.
